  2. 24 de mar. de 2023 · Princess Marie Alexandra was killed in an attack by the U.S. Army Air Forces during an air-raid on Frankfurt am Main on 29–30 January 1944 during World War II. She and seven other women, who were aid workers, were killed when the cellar, in which they had taken refuge, collapsed under the weight of the building, rendering Marie Alexandra's body barely recognisable.

Princess Marie Alexandra of Baden (1902-1944) was a daughter of Prince Maximilian of Baden (1867–1929) and Princess Marie Louise of Hanover and Cumberland . On 17 September 1924 she married en:Prince Wolfgang of Hesse (1896–1989), the heir of the would-be en:King of Finland .

Alexandrine of Baden (Alexandrine Luise Amalie Friederike Elisabeth Sophie; 6 December 1820 – 20 December 1904) was Duchess of Saxe-Coburg and Gotha from 29 January 1844 to 22 August 1893 as the wife of Duke Ernest II. She was the eldest child of Leopold, Grand Duke of Baden, and his wife Princess Sophie of Sweden .

  7. 13 de sept. de 2017 · Prinzessin Marie Alexandra war die einzige Tochter von Maximilian von Baden, der 1918 das Amt des Reichskanzlers bekleidete und der Prinzessin Maria-Luise von Hannover-Cumberland. Ihre Großeltern väterlicherseits waren Prinz Wilhelm von Baden und Prinzessin Maria von Leuchtenberg, einer Enkelin von Zar Nikolaus I. von Russland und Eugène de Beauharnais, dem Stiefsohn Napoleons.
